215. Deputy Willie O'Dea asked the Minister for Children and Youth Affairs if she will re-examine regulations recently introduced by Tusla, the Child and Family Agency which will compel childminders to complete Fetac level 5; if she is aware that this change in regulations may compel many persons who are providing childminding services in their own homes to discontinue this practice; if she is further aware that this will be a serious inconvenience to parents who prefer this arrangement rather than sending their children to a crèche; and if she will make a statement on the matter. [18574/16]
